翻譯|使用教程|編輯:李顯亮|2021-05-10 10:38:21.633|閱讀 428 次
概述:本文演示了如何將常規(guī)注釋和富文本注釋添加到Excel文件,以及如何使用Spire.XLS for Java閱讀注釋。
# 界面/圖表報表/文檔/IDE等千款熱門軟控件火熱銷售中 >>
相關(guān)鏈接:
Spire.XLS for Java是專業(yè)的Java Excel API,使開發(fā)人員無需使用Microsoft Office或Microsoft Excel即可創(chuàng)建,管理,操作,轉(zhuǎn)換和打印Excel工作表。
本文演示了如何將常規(guī)注釋和富文本注釋添加到Excel文件,以及如何使用Spire.XLS for Java閱讀注釋。
添加評論
import com.spire.xls.*; public class InsertComments { public static void main(String[] args){ //Create a Workbook instance Workbook workbook = new Workbook(); //Get the first worksheet Worksheet sheet = workbook.getWorksheets().get(0); //Create fonts ExcelFont font = workbook.createFont(); font.setFontName("Arial"); font.setSize(11); font.setKnownColor(ExcelColors.Orange); ExcelFont fontBlue = workbook.createFont(); fontBlue.setKnownColor(ExcelColors.LightBlue); ExcelFont fontGreen = workbook.createFont(); fontGreen.setKnownColor(ExcelColors.LightGreen); //Add regular comment to specific cell range CellRange range = sheet.getCellRange("A1"); range.setText("Regular comment"); range.getComment().setText("Regular comment"); range.autoFitColumns(); //Add rich text comment to specific cell range range = sheet.getCellRange("A2"); range.setText("Rich text comment"); range.getRichText().setFont(0, 16, font); range.autoFitColumns(); range.getComment().getRichText().setText("Rich text comment"); range.getComment().getRichText().setFont(0, 4, fontGreen); range.getComment().getRichText().setFont(5, 9, fontBlue); //Save the resultant file workbook.saveToFile("AddComments.xlsx", ExcelVersion.Version2013); } }
常規(guī)評論
富文本評論
閱讀評論
import com.spire.xls.Workbook; import com.spire.xls.Worksheet; public class ReadComments { public static void main(String[] args){ //Load Excel file Workbook workbook = new Workbook(); workbook.loadFromFile("AddComments.xlsx"); //Get the first worksheet Worksheet sheet = workbook.getWorksheets().get(0); //Print out the comment System.out.println("A1 Comment = " + sheet.getCellRange("A1").getComment().getText()); System.out.println("A2 Comment = " + sheet.getCellRange("A2").getComment().getRichText().getRtfText()); } }
本站文章除注明轉(zhuǎn)載外,均為本站原創(chuàng)或翻譯。歡迎任何形式的轉(zhuǎn)載,但請務(wù)必注明出處、不得修改原文相關(guān)鏈接,如果存在內(nèi)容上的異議請郵件反饋至chenjj@fc6vip.cn